An Exploratory Trial of a Health Education Programme Based on the Social and Emotional Competence in Children

Summary

The purpose of this study was to evaluate whether an intervention based on the social and emotional competence development improves the healthy lifestyles adoption in young children.

Interventions

BEHAVIORAL

CRECES programme

The first unit of CRECES programme was implemented in 8 sessions. Each session was 40-50 minutes long and delivered during four weeks. Parents were provided with home-extension activities.
